Swarm UI

The swarm's own web surface, served by the gateway on the swarm apex (services.hyperhive.swarm.domain) and readable only by operators.

Distinct from the per-hive dashboard, which lives on the hive domain and answers for one host. This one is the view across hives.

Enabling

services.hyperhive.swarm.ui.enable = true;   # defaults to swarm.controller.enable

Derived from the controller rather than from enableRequiredServices: the UI is a view onto the controller's state and reaches it over that daemon's socket, so the host that runs the controller is the host that can serve the UI. A hive that merely uses a swarm has nothing to serve.

swarm.ui.domain defaults to the swarm apex and can be pinned, the same way swarm.forge.domain and swarm.matrix.gatewayHost can.

The apex must differ from services.hyperhive.domain. The gateway's default server already answers for the hive domain, and two vhosts claiming one server_name do not error — nginx picks one — so this is an assertion rather than a runtime surprise.

🔑 You must be in the admins group

This is the step that separates "protected" from "locked out". The vhost's auth_request asks authelia "is there a session"; the rule that makes it mean "is this an operator" is an access_control entry requiring group:admins. An account without that group authenticates fine and still gets bounced.

swarmctl user add <you> --group admins

admins deliberately, not a new word: ../setup.md has told every operator to create exactly that group since the bootstrap step existed, so an account made by following the guide already passes. This is the first rule that consumes a group name — inventing a second one would have meant those accounts silently failing a check they were supposed to pass.

An account created without any group needs re-adding with the flag — swarmctl treats the existing entry as the canonical store, so the group is what changes.

Why a group and not a list of usernames: agents are getting authelia accounts of their own (matrix SSO), and authenticated would then include every agent in the hive. The group is the only thing standing between "an operator's page" and "anyone with a session".

What it costs to be reachable

The apex is published to the hive's resolver like every other swarm service, so agent containers can resolve it. That is deliberate and it is not a hole: reachability is not the access control here. An agent that resolves the name and connects still has no operator session, and the subrequest denies it.

Four wiring sites

Adding a swarm service name means touching all four. Missing one ships as a different flavour of "works from the host, broken from a container":

site file
vhost nix/host-modules/hive-gateway/vhosts.nix
certificate name nix/host-modules/swarm.nix (serviceDomains)
DNS record nix/host-modules/hive-gateway/dnsmasq.nix
local-dev hosts nix/host-modules/hive-gateway/default.nix

⚠️ The certificate one is the least obvious and the most visible when missed. serviceDomains is both the services sub-CA's nameConstraints set and the leaf's SAN list, and the apex is a sibling of forge.<swarm> / chat.<swarm> / auth.<swarm>, not a parent — no CA in the hierarchy issues for it implicitly. Left out, the vhost falls back to the hive leaf and the swarm's front page opens with a name mismatch.
